文件名称:callServer
- 所属分类:
- JSP源码/Java
- 资源属性:
- [Java] [源码]
- 上传时间:
- 2017-02-07
- 文件大小:
- 4.62mb
- 下载次数:
- 0次
- 提 供 者:
- 张**
- 相关连接:
- 无
- 下载说明:
- 别用迅雷下载,失败请重下,重下不扣分!
下载
别用迅雷、360浏览器下载。
如迅雷强制弹出,可右键点击选“另存为”。
失败请重下,重下不扣分。
如迅雷强制弹出,可右键点击选“另存为”。
失败请重下,重下不扣分。
介绍说明--下载内容均来自于网络,请自行研究使用
1. 用户通过websocket与netty创建通讯
2. 用户链接到服务器队列中
3. 队列通过轮训机制判定netty是否有可以服务的客服
4. 如果有则将队列中的用户channel转给客服进行点对点通讯
5. 队列有自己的最大容载量
6. 每个客服可以同时服务N个用户
7. 没有空闲客服的时候用户们只能在队列中慢慢排队
8. 队列状态及实时位置由队列向队列内用户推送
9. 当有空闲位置的时候,轮训机制会将队列中首位用户放到netty中进行与客服的通讯挂钩
10. 其实对于服务器队列可以抽出来做到一个单独的项目中,用户先访问队列项目,队列项目再将用户channel发送给处理消息的netty项目
2. 用户链接到服务器队列中
3. 队列通过轮训机制判定netty是否有可以服务的客服
4. 如果有则将队列中的用户channel转给客服进行点对点通讯
5. 队列有自己的最大容载量
6. 每个客服可以同时服务N个用户
7. 没有空闲客服的时候用户们只能在队列中慢慢排队
8. 队列状态及实时位置由队列向队列内用户推送
9. 当有空闲位置的时候,轮训机制会将队列中首位用户放到netty中进行与客服的通讯挂钩
10. 其实对于服务器队列可以抽出来做到一个单独的项目中,用户先访问队列项目,队列项目再将用户channel发送给处理消息的netty项目
(系统自动生成,下载前可以参看下载内容)
下载文件列表
callServer\.classpath
..........\.project
..........\.settings\org.eclipse.core.resources.prefs
..........\.........\org.eclipse.jdt.core.prefs
..........\bin\com\model\Data.class
..........\...\...\.....\JSONtype.class
..........\...\...\.....\SysCode.class
..........\...\...\.....\Type.class
..........\...\...\.....\UserServerPojo.class
..........\...\...\service\core\action\Create.class
..........\...\...\.......\....\......\Join.class
..........\...\...\.......\....\......\Msg.class
..........\...\...\.......\....\ContainerChange.class
..........\...\...\.......\....\DbService.class
..........\...\...\.......\....\ServerThread.class
..........\...\...\.......\MsgExecute.class
..........\...\...\.......\MsgHandler.class
..........\...\...\.......\Server$1.class
..........\...\...\.......\Server$2.class
..........\...\...\.......\Server$3.class
..........\...\...\.......\Server.class
..........\...\...\.......\WebSocketHandler.class
..........\...\...\StartMsgService.class
..........\...\...\tools\IniConf.class
..........\...\...\.....\ServerLog.class
..........\...\log4j.properties
..........\...\SysConfig.properties
..........\lib\commons-beanutils-1.8.0.jar
..........\...\commons-collections-3.2.jar
..........\...\commons-lang-2.4.jar
..........\...\commons-logging.jar
..........\...\ezmorph-1.0.6.jar
..........\...\json-lib-2.4-jdk15.jar
..........\...\log4j-1.2.17.jar
..........\...\netty-all-4.1.6.Final.jar
..........\src\com\model\Data.java
..........\...\...\.....\JSONtype.java
..........\...\...\.....\SysCode.java
..........\...\...\.....\Type.java
..........\...\...\.....\UserServerPojo.java
..........\...\...\service\core\action\Create.java
..........\...\...\.......\....\......\Join.java
..........\...\...\.......\....\......\Msg.java
..........\...\...\.......\....\ContainerChange.java
..........\...\...\.......\....\DbService.java
..........\...\...\.......\....\ServerThread.java
..........\...\...\.......\MsgExecute.java
..........\...\...\.......\MsgHandler.java
..........\...\...\.......\Server.java
..........\...\...\.......\WebSocketHandler.java
..........\...\...\StartMsgService.java
..........\...\...\tools\IniConf.java
..........\...\...\.....\ServerLog.java
..........\...\log4j.properties
..........\...\SysConfig.properties
..........\bin\com\service\core\action
..........\src\com\service\core\action
..........\bin\com\service\core
..........\src\com\service\core
..........\bin\com\model
..........\...\...\service
..........\...\...\tools
..........\src\com\model
..........\...\...\service
..........\...\...\tools
..........\bin\com
..........\src\com
..........\.settings
..........\bin
..........\lib
..........\src
callServer